Quiz Answer Key and Fun Facts
1. "Allen"- What is the name of the man Linc is convicted of murdering?

Answer: Terrance Steadman

Terrance is the Vice President's brother, and Lincoln worked for his company. Two weeks after a public altercation between the two men, Lincoln is set up for his murder. There is a parking garage video tape, and this is what convicted him. The truth was that Steadman was dead before Lincoln got to the man's car.
2. "Allen"- Known to people by Crab, what is the last name of the man who could have exonerated Lincoln?

Answer: Simmons

Crab set Lincoln up to take the fall for Steadman's death. His girlfriend Leticia finally tells Veronica Donovan as much of the story as she knows. These men, she feels like they are government men, come to Crab and buy off Linc's $90,000 debt. The exchange is that Crab sends Linc to the parking garage when they need him there.

He tells Linc it is to get rid of a scum bag drug dealer. This part of the story Linc tells Veronica himself.
3. "Allen"- Did Lincoln confess to Veronica he was high on drugs the night he was framed for the murder?

Answer: Yes

Linc was nervous about killing the man. He did not want to do it, but Crab assured him the man was a low life, or scum bag, drug dealer. If Linc did this, Crab agreed to wipe the $90,000 slate clean. During Linc's story to Veronica, we see him smoking a joint while preparing to approach the car. So, marijuana was his high of choice on that night. Linc has never been shown to be a drug abuser, so this was a mild surprise for me. Linc went on to say he never pulled the trigger on his gun that night inside the parking garage.
4. "Cell Test"- During the episode Michael hides a cell phone inside a utility box.

Answer: False

He hid what appeared to be a cell phone, and put his cellmate Fernando Sucre to the test. He told him he hoped the he never said anything about the phone, and his Fernando became instantly paranoid. He said just having a cell phone inside the prison could take three years on to a sentence.
5. "Cell Test"- What present, taken in the previous episode "Allen", did John Abruzzi have for the visiting mobster?

Answer: Michael's toes

John handed the toes over in a little box, and added that Michael would not talk. Later in the episode, he realized there was no way pain would get what he needed from Michael. While I am sure Michael was prepared that he would experience violence, he still seemed mighty shaken by the toe removal incident.
6. "Cell Test"- The item Michael placed inside the utility box was made out of soap.

Answer: True

When Fernando found out that he wouldn't be able to call his fiancee Maricruz after all, he was extremely upset. Michael took the "cell phone" and broke it in half to demonstrate that it was not real.
7. "Cute Poison"- Michael's new cellmate, Charles "Haywire" Pitociak, describes his mental disorder as schizo effective disorder with _________.

Answer: bi-polar tendencies

Haywire faked taking his medicine. He would swallow the pills, and then instantly vomit them back up. Haywire also could not sleep, which further placed Michael behind schedule because he could not dig behind the cell commode. Michael devised a plan to get Haywire removed his cell, and it was the warden who allowed him to figure out how to do it.

The warden said only evidence of violence or sexual predation would get an inmate transferred out of a cell. Silas Weir Mitchell did a great job portraying Haywire. Silas has guest starred on many TV series since the mid 1990s.

Some of his appearances were on "ER", "The Pretender", "24", and all three "CSI" series- "CSI", "CSI:Miami" and "CSI:NY".
8. "Cute Poison"- Lincoln directs Veronica to an organization that might be able to help her handle his case. He said to go see Ben Forsik at _________.

Answer: Project Justice

Lincoln had already sent all of his files over to Ben, but had not been able to get any help from Project Justice. The case against Linc was so tight that Ben was not able to help. This is exactly what Ben told Veronica as well, but another Justice worker came to offer her help later in the episode. This man is Nick Sarvinn.
9. "Cute Poison"- Where were Michael and Haywire located when Haywire figures out that Michael's body art is a pattern?

Answer: showers

Haywire was very interested in Michael's tattoos. He even shared an embarrassing story from his school days to get Michael to reveal a secret to him. It isn't until they are in the showers that he can see the entire tattoo. He instantly recognizes a pattern under the top artwork and draws it out on several sheets of paper. Michael knows that he has to get Haywire out of his cell as soon as possible.

He steals the man's toothpaste, in order to get a carrying case for his chemicals, and this sets Haywire off. Michael injures himself and calls to the guards for help.

They remove Haywire just as he is saying, " He's got the pathway on his body. It leads somewhere." As the drag a struggling Haywire from the cell, he claims it is the pathway to hell.
10. "Cute Poison"- What two items did Michael need to make his cute poison?

Answer: masonry cleaner and root control

Cute poison was an abbreviation for CuSo and PO, copper sulfate and phosphoric acid. Michael went into the prison's toxic control center and handed the inmate on duty a carton of cigarettes to let him in and steal what he needed. He was able to retrieve the masonry cleaner before officer Officer Bellick caught him.

It is later that John Abruzzi delivers the root cleaner to him. He puts each ingredient inside a toothpaste tube. He uses the chemicals, one at a time, to create a corrosive agent that eats metals.

He lets the stuff loose inside the infirmary drain and at the end of the episode is able to break through the brick behind his cell toilet. After Haywire is removed, Fernando rejoins Michael and offers help in the escape. He sings very loudly and causes a distraction so that Michael can kick the brick back into the open space behind the wall. Michael is no longer behind schedule.
